xrdp is ok if you are local, but we support alot of customers all over the country and alot don't have the fastest inet connections, so tunneling x win over their links isn't feasible. :)
As far as database credentials, SO uses root with no password for local only logins… you can't login a remote sensor with root, nor would you want to, so we create a user per sensor - i.e. location-fw-interface in mysql and only give them privs on the snorby DB.
after that we open port 3306 (mysql) ONLY from the sensor to the security onion box (we delete all other ufw rules except port 444 for snorby), I don't like that SO allows connections from anywhere.
You also have to go into /etc/mysql/my.conf and change the 'bind address' to 0.0.0.0 and then do a 'service restart mysql' - it defaults to 127.0.0.1 which will not allow your remote sensors to connect.

This version of the Snort package made some big changes to Barnyard2 like adding more output plugins. One side effect of that was it needed to reconfigure how the MySQL DB login info was stored. I wrote some code in the installation routines that attempts to migrate the old MySQL settings to the new format. It is possible some old settings could trip it up. Your error is a MySQL login error, and when the login fails Barnyard2 will stop. Go to the Barnyard tab in Snort and manually re-enter the login ID and password for the MySQL DB, then click Save. Try to start Barnyard2 after that on the Snort Interfaces tab.
Bill

I think I found the cause of Barnyard2 trying to login to the DB as "root". It happened when a sensor name value was provided (that is, when the field was not blank). The code was including a comma after the sensor name in the barnyard2.conf file and there is not supposed to be one there. That was apparently confusing the parser for Barnyard2. The latest update for the Snort package that is being reviewed by the Core Team has this fixed. When they approve and merge the change, a new Snort update will appear under System…Packages.

Within the current GUI code that can't happen because it tests for an interface already being "Snort-configured" before letting you save a newly added interface. So from that narrow point of view the answer is "no, it's not technically possible". However, from a broader point of view, I suppose it could be done but it would take a lot of additional complexity within the GUI code to handle that situation. Some additional UUIDs would have to be assigned to each interface to identify each configured "thread" on an interface. This is because each Snort process needs it own separate configuration file and logging directories. Currently those are identified and named using the physical interface name and a UUID as part of the path name.
According to the Snort people (when comparing themselves to Suricata), the claim is no huge benefit to "threading" with Snort. I am not expert enough in all the subtleties to know, though.
I am quite close to having the Suricata blocking plugin ready, and Suricata is multi-threaded out of the gate. For the initial release, Suricata will use the same libpcap and pf table block mechanism as Snort does. This is because true inline IPS mode needs some critical changes in the ipfw code in pfSense.

They claim there isn't a huge benefit to threading. They didn't say there wasn't a benefit to multiple processes. I believe that's the whole point behind PF_RING.
The difference here is that instead of distributing packets on a round-robin basis to identically-configured snort processes, I was proposing using multiple snort instances, each getting all the packets, with different rule-sets.
I agree that suricata should come first. If you plan to continue to maintain snort after suricata's "completion" though, I'd like to push this as a feature request.
